Caramel Apple Cheesecake Bars
Delightful Caramel Apple Cheesecake Bars blend creamy cheesecake with tart apples and rich caramel, perfect for any occasion.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 40 minutes
- Total Time: 55 minutes
- Yield: 12 servings 1x
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Ingredients
- 1 cup graham cracker crumbs
- 1/4 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 2 (8 oz) packages c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up sugar
- 3 large e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 medium apples, peeled and diced
- 1/2 cup caramel sauce
- 1/2 tsp cinnamon
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×9-inch baking dish.
- In a bowl, combine graham cracker crumbs, 1/4 cup sugar, and melted butter. Press this mixture into the bottom of the prepared dish.
- In a large mixing bowl, beat together the softened cream cheese and 1 cup sugar until smooth and creamy.
-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ract.
- Fold in the diced apples and sprinkle in the cinnamon. Pour the cream cheese blend over the crust in the baking dish.
- Drizzle the caramel sauce over the cheesecake mixture.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until the center is set.
- Allow to cool before refrigerating for at least 2 hours.
- Serve chilled and enjoy!
Notes
For best results, ensure your cream cheese is at room temperature and avoid overmixing the batter. These bars can be served with extra caramel or alongside ice cream.

Storage & Reheat Tips
Once cooled, keep your Caramel Apple Cheesecake Bars chilled in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week. They also freeze beautifully; just make sure to wrap them tightly to maintain their texture. When you’re ready to indulge, allow them to thaw in the fridge overnight for the best results. There’s no need for reheating—serve them cold for that refreshing bite.
Smart Tips
- Room Temperature Cream Cheese: Make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ature before mixing. It ensures a lump-free filling and a creamy texture.
- Caramel Sauce Variety: Experiment with flavored caramel sauces, like sea salt or maple, to give your bars a fun twist.
- Apples Matter: Use firm apples like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p. They hold their shape while baking and give good tartness to balance the sweetness.

Quick Questions, Straight Answers
Can I use different types of apples?
Absolutely! While Granny Smith and Honeycrisp are great for their tartness, feel free to experiment with other varieties for a sweeter taste.
How can I ensure the bars don’t crack?
Avoid overmixing the batter once the eggs are added, and don’t open the oven door during baking. A gentle bake helps keep them smooth.
What if I don’t have caramel sauce?
You can make a quick homemade caramel by melting sugar until golden, then carefully adding butter and cream. Just be cautious—sugar can burn quickly!
Can these bars be made ahead of time?
Definitely! They keep well in the fridge for several days, making them perfect for prepping ahead for events or gatherings.
